Sports Facilities and Fields
One of the park's standout features is its extensive sports complex. It includes multiple baseball and softball fields, soccer fields, and a dedicated splash pad for younger visitors during warmer months. These fields are meticulously maintained, providing excellent playing surfaces for local leagues and tournaments. Walking and Jogging Trails
The network of trails at Cane Ridge Park is a major asset for fitness enthusiasts and nature walkers alike. These paved and unpaved paths offer varying degrees of difficulty and scenic views. Our analysis indicates that accessible trails are crucial for community health and well-being.
Paved Paths for Accessibility
Several paved trails ensure that the park is accessible to everyone, including those with strollers, wheelchairs, or other mobility aids. These paths are well-maintained and offer a smooth surface for walking, running, or cycling.
Natural Surface Trails
For a more immersive nature experience, unpaved trails meander through wooded sections of the park. These paths provide opportunities for birdwatching and observing local flora and fauna. We recommend these trails for those seeking a quieter, more natural setting.

Park Hours and Access
Cane Ridge Park is typically open from dawn until dusk. It's always a good idea to check the official Metro Parks website for any specific hours, event closures, or seasonal changes before your visit. Access to the park is free, making it an accessible recreational resource for the entire community. — Caucasian Shepherd Dog Price: Costs & Factors
